How they compare

Portugal currently reports 1,518 Thousand heads (animals) against 1,400 Thousand heads (animals) in Sweden, a difference of 118 Thousand heads (animals).

That makes Portugal's figure about 1.1 times Sweden's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 17 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Sweden ahead.

Portugal ranks 14th and Sweden ranks 17th of 28 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Portugal averaged higher in 2 and Sweden in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Portugal Sweden Difference Ahead
1990s 1,343 Thousand heads (animals) 1,786 Thousand heads (animals) 442.63 Thousand heads (animals) Sweden
2010s 1,705 Thousand heads (animals) 1,491 Thousand heads (animals) 214.35 Thousand heads (animals) Portugal
2020s 1,636 Thousand heads (animals) 1,435 Thousand heads (animals) 200.69 Thousand heads (animals) Portugal

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
